Section 12-21-2-7 - Contracts; powers; approval; requisites
(a) The secretary may act for the division in entering into contracts for the disbursal of money and the providing of service.
(b) Before entering into a contract under this section, the secretary shall submit the contract to the attorney general for approval as to form and legality.
(c) A contract under this section must do the following:
(1) Specify the services to be provided and the client populations to whom services must be provided.
(2) Provide for a reduction in funding for the failure to comply with terms of the contract.
